Legal Assistant providing high-quality paralegal and corporate records support to NANA Regional Corporation. Managing corporate governance and compliance processes while ensuring confidentiality and accuracy from Anchorage.
Responsibilities
Provide high-quality paralegal, legal administrative, and corporate records support to NANA Regional Corporation (NRC) and designated subsidiaries.
Maintain complete, accurate, and auditable corporate records for NRC and designated subsidiaries (minute books, resolutions, consents, officer/director rosters).
Manage the corporate records system (organization, storage, retrieval; physical and electronic), applying approved naming conventions and retention schedules.
Prepare the NRC proxy statement and support other Annual Meeting activities, including Board election logistics and compliance requirements.
Coordinate Board and committee meeting materials with the Board Support Team; create/compile agendas, exhibits, and packets; ensure timely distribution via Director’s Desk (or successor board portal).
Attend NRC Board meetings as requested; perform roll call; draft and route minutes; finalize and upload resolutions and minutes to the board portal.
Oversee archive processes for corporate records; coordinate off ‑ site storage and retrieval as needed.
Maintain and oversee legal department outside counsel spreadsheet (Code law firm invoices for attorney’s approval and maintain a fiscal year spreadsheet of law firm expenses).
Prepare and file required corporate/entity filings for NRC; assist subsidiaries with filings upon request.
Prepare, submit, and track state filings (e.g., biennial reports, business licenses/renewals, trade names, trademarks) ensuring accuracy and on ‑ time completion.
Maintain compliance calendars and reminders; proactively resolve filing discrepancies.
Implement and monitor legal holds; coordinate preservation, collection, review, and production of documents (paper and electronic).
Organize discovery responses (collect, review, stamp, index); maintain privilege logs and production logs.
Support internal investigations, fact development, and matter tracking in collaboration with internal stakeholders and outside counsel.
Coordinate document execution, notarization, and delivery for transactions; assemble closing sets and electronic closing books.
Track signature packets and diligence materials; ensure version control and secure transmission.
Conduct targeted Alaska statutory and regulatory research; summarize findings and recommend next steps.
Draft correspondence, memoranda, checklists, templates, and standard forms.
Proofread and format legal documents to NRC standards.
